<?php
/**
 * This code was generated by
 * ___ _ _ _ _ _    _ ____    ____ ____ _    ____ ____ _  _ ____ ____ ____ ___ __   __
 *  |  | | | | |    | |  | __ |  | |__| | __ | __ |___ |\ | |___ |__/ |__|  | |  | |__/
 *  |  |_|_| | |___ | |__|    |__| |  | |    |__] |___ | \| |___ |  \ |  |  | |__| |   *
 * Twilio - Api
 * This is the public Twilio REST API.
 *
 * NOTE: This class is auto generated by OpenAPI Generator.
 * https://openapi-generator.tech
 * Do not edit the class manually.
 */

namespace Twilio\Rest\Api\V2010\Account\Conference;

use Twilio\Options;
use Twilio\Values;

abstract class ParticipantOptions
{
    /**
     * @param string $statusCallback The URL we should call using the `status_callback_method` to send status information to your application.
     * @param string $statusCallbackMethod The HTTP method we should use to call `status_callback`. Can be: `GET` and `POST` and defaults to `POST`.
     * @param string[] $statusCallbackEvent The conference state changes that should generate a call to `status_callback`. Can be: `initiated`, `ringing`, `answered`, and `completed`. Separate multiple values with a space. The default value is `completed`.
     * @param string $label A label for this participant. If one is supplied, it may subsequently be used to fetch, update or delete the participant.
     * @param int $timeout The number of seconds that we should allow the phone to ring before assuming there is no answer. Can be an integer between `5` and `600`, inclusive. The default value is `60`. We always add a 5-second timeout buffer to outgoing calls, so  value of 10 would result in an actual timeout that was closer to 15 seconds.
     * @param bool $record Whether to record the participant and their conferences, including the time between conferences. Can be `true` or `false` and the default is `false`.
     * @param bool $muted Whether the agent is muted in the conference. Can be `true` or `false` and the default is `false`.
     * @param string $beep Whether to play a notification beep to the conference when the participant joins. Can be: `true`, `false`, `onEnter`, or `onExit`. The default value is `true`.
     * @param bool $startConferenceOnEnter Whether to start the conference when the participant joins, if it has not already started. Can be: `true` or `false` and the default is `true`. If `false` and the conference has not started, the participant is muted and hears background music until another participant starts the conference.
     * @param bool $endConferenceOnExit Whether to end the conference when the participant leaves. Can be: `true` or `false` and defaults to `false`.
     * @param string $waitUrl The URL we should call using the `wait_method` for the music to play while participants are waiting for the conference to start. The default value is the URL of our standard hold music. [Learn more about hold music](https://www.twilio.com/labs/twimlets/holdmusic).
     * @param string $waitMethod The HTTP method we should use to call `wait_url`. Can be `GET` or `POST` and the default is `POST`. When using a static audio file, this should be `GET` so that we can cache the file.
     * @param bool $earlyMedia Whether to allow an agent to hear the state of the outbound call, including ringing or disconnect messages. Can be: `true` or `false` and defaults to `true`.
     * @param int $maxParticipants The maximum number of participants in the conference. Can be a positive integer from `2` to `250`. The default value is `250`.
     * @param string $conferenceRecord Whether to record the conference the participant is joining. Can be: `true`, `false`, `record-from-start`, and `do-not-record`. The default value is `false`.
     * @param string $conferenceTrim Whether to trim leading and trailing silence from the conference recording. Can be: `trim-silence` or `do-not-trim` and defaults to `trim-silence`.
     * @param string $conferenceStatusCallback The URL we should call using the `conference_status_callback_method` when the conference events in `conference_status_callback_event` occur. Only the value set by the first participant to join the conference is used. Subsequent `conference_status_callback` values are ignored.
     * @param string $conferenceStatusCallbackMethod The HTTP method we should use to call `conference_status_callback`. Can be: `GET` or `POST` and defaults to `POST`.
     * @param string[] $conferenceStatusCallbackEvent The conference state changes that should generate a call to `conference_status_callback`. Can be: `start`, `end`, `join`, `leave`, `mute`, `hold`, `modify`, `speaker`, and `announcement`. Separate multiple values with a space. Defaults to `start end`.
     * @param string $recordingChannels The recording channels for the final recording. Can be: `mono` or `dual` and the default is `mono`.
     * @param string $recordingStatusCallback The URL that we should call using the `recording_status_callback_method` when the recording status changes.
     * @param string $recordingStatusCallbackMethod The HTTP method we should use when we call `recording_status_callback`. Can be: `GET` or `POST` and defaults to `POST`.
     * @param string $sipAuthUsername The SIP username used for authentication.
     * @param string $sipAuthPassword The SIP password for authentication.
     * @param string $region The [region](https://support.twilio.com/hc/en-us/articles/223132167-How-global-low-latency-routing-and-region-selection-work-for-conferences-and-Client-calls) where we should mix the recorded audio. Can be:`us1`, `ie1`, `de1`, `sg1`, `br1`, `au1`, or `jp1`.
     * @param string $conferenceRecordingStatusCallback The URL we should call using the `conference_recording_status_callback_method` when the conference recording is available.
     * @param string $conferenceRecordingStatusCallbackMethod The HTTP method we should use to call `conference_recording_status_callback`. Can be: `GET` or `POST` and defaults to `POST`.
     * @param string[] $recordingStatusCallbackEvent The recording state changes that should generate a call to `recording_status_callback`. Can be: `started`, `in-progress`, `paused`, `resumed`, `stopped`, `completed`, `failed`, and `absent`. Separate multiple values with a space, ex: `'in-progress completed failed'`.
     * @param string[] $conferenceRecordingStatusCallbackEvent The conference recording state changes that generate a call to `conference_recording_status_callback`. Can be: `in-progress`, `completed`, `failed`, and `absent`. Separate multiple values with a space, ex: `'in-progress completed failed'`
     * @param bool $coaching Whether the participant is coaching another call. Can be: `true` or `false`. If not present, defaults to `false` unless `call_sid_to_coach` is defined. If `true`, `call_sid_to_coach` must be defined.
     * @param string $callSidToCoach The SID of the participant who is being `coached`. The participant being coached is the only participant who can hear the participant who is `coaching`.
     * @param string $jitterBufferSize Jitter buffer size for the connecting participant. Twilio will use this setting to apply Jitter Buffer before participant's audio is mixed into the conference. Can be: `off`, `small`, `medium`, and `large`. Default to `large`.
     * @param string $byoc The SID of a BYOC (Bring Your Own Carrier) trunk to route this call with. Note that `byoc` is only meaningful when `to` is a phone number; it will otherwise be ignored. (Beta)
     * @param string $callerId The phone number, Client identifier, or username portion of SIP address that made this call. Phone numbers are in [E.164](https://www.twilio.com/docs/glossary/what-e164) format (e.g., +16175551212). Client identifiers are formatted `client:name`. If using a phone number, it must be a Twilio number or a Verified [outgoing caller id](https://www.twilio.com/docs/voice/api/outgoing-caller-ids) for your account. If the `to` parameter is a phone number, `callerId` must also be a phone number. If `to` is sip address, this value of `callerId` should be a username portion to be used to populate the From header that is passed to the SIP endpoint.
     * @param string $callReason The Reason for the outgoing call. Use it to specify the purpose of the call that is presented on the called party's phone. (Branded Calls Beta)
     * @param string $recordingTrack The audio track to record for the call. Can be: `inbound`, `outbound` or `both`. The default is `both`. `inbound` records the audio that is received by Twilio. `outbound` records the audio that is sent from Twilio. `both` records the audio that is received and sent by Twilio.
     * @param int $timeLimit The maximum duration of the call in seconds. Constraints depend on account and configuration.
     * @param string $machineDetection Whether to detect if a human, answering machine, or fax has picked up the call. Can be: `Enable` or `DetectMessageEnd`. Use `Enable` if you would like us to return `AnsweredBy` as soon as the called party is identified. Use `DetectMessageEnd`, if you would like to leave a message on an answering machine. For more information, see [Answering Machine Detection](https://www.twilio.com/docs/voice/answering-machine-detection).
     * @param int $machineDetectionTimeout The number of seconds that we should attempt to detect an answering machine before timing out and sending a voice request with `AnsweredBy` of `unknown`. The default timeout is 30 seconds.
     * @param int $machineDetectionSpeechThreshold The number of milliseconds that is used as the measuring stick for the length of the speech activity, where durations lower than this value will be interpreted as a human and longer than this value as a machine. Possible Values: 1000-6000. Default: 2400.
     * @param int $machineDetectionSpeechEndThreshold The number of milliseconds of silence after speech activity at which point the speech activity is considered complete. Possible Values: 500-5000. Default: 1200.
     * @param int $machineDetectionSilenceTimeout The number of milliseconds of initial silence after which an `unknown` AnsweredBy result will be returned. Possible Values: 2000-10000. Default: 5000.
     * @param string $amdStatusCallback The URL that we should call using the `amd_status_callback_method` to notify customer application whether the call was answered by human, machine or fax.
     * @param string $amdStatusCallbackMethod The HTTP method we should use when calling the `amd_status_callback` URL. Can be: `GET` or `POST` and the default is `POST`.
     * @param string $trim Whether to trim any leading and trailing silence from the participant recording. Can be: `trim-silence` or `do-not-trim` and the default is `trim-silence`.
     * @param string $callToken A token string needed to invoke a forwarded call. A call_token is generated when an incoming call is received on a Twilio number. Pass an incoming call's call_token value to a forwarded call via the call_token parameter when creating a new call. A forwarded call should bear the same CallerID of the original incoming call.
     * @return CreateParticipantOptions Options builder
     */
    public static function create(
        
        string $statusCallback = Values::NONE,
        string $statusCallbackMethod = Values::NONE,
        array $statusCallbackEvent = Values::ARRAY_NONE,
        string $label = Values::NONE,
        int $timeout = Values::INT_NONE,
        bool $record =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        bool $muted =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        string $beep = Values::NONE,
        bool $startConferenceOnEnter =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        bool $endConferenceOnExit =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        string $waitUrl = Values::NONE,
        string $waitMethod = Values::NONE,
        bool $earlyMedia =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        int $maxParticipants = Values::INT_NONE,
        string $conferenceRecord = Values::NONE,
        string $conferenceTrim = Values::NONE,
        string $conferenceStatusCallback = Values::NONE,
        string $conferenceStatusCallbackMethod = Values::NONE,
        array $conferenceStatusCallbackEvent = Values::ARRAY_NONE,
        string $recordingChannels = Values::NONE,
        string $recordingStatusCallback = Values::NONE,
        string $recordingStatusCallbackMethod = Values::NONE,
        string $sipAuthUsername = Values::NONE,
        string $sipAuthPassword = Values::NONE,
        string $region = Values::NONE,
        string $conferenceRecordingStatusCallback = Values::NONE,
        string $conferenceRecordingStatusCallbackMethod = Values::NONE,
        array $recordingStatusCallbackEvent = Values::ARRAY_NONE,
        array $conferenceRecordingStatusCallbackEvent = Values::ARRAY_NONE,
        bool $coaching =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        string $callSidToCoach = Values::NONE,
        string $jitterBufferSize = Values::NONE,
        string $byoc = Values::NONE,
        string $callerId = Values::NONE,
        string $callReason = Values::NONE,
        string $recordingTrack = Values::NONE,
        int $timeLimit = Values::INT_NONE,
        string $machineDetection = Values::NONE,
        int $machineDetectionTimeout = Values::INT_NONE,
        int $machineDetectionSpeechThreshold = Values::INT_NONE,
        int $machineDetectionSpeechEndThreshold = Values::INT_NONE,
        int $machineDetectionSilenceTimeout = Values::INT_NONE,
        string $amdStatusCallback = Values::NONE,
        string $amdStatusCallbackMethod = Values::NONE,
        string $trim = Values::NONE,
        string $callToken = Values::NONE

    ): CreateParticipantOptions
    {
        return new CreateParticipantOptions(
            $statusCallback,
            $statusCallbackMethod,
            $statusCallbackEvent,
            $label,
            $timeout,
            $record,
            $muted,
            $beep,
            $startConferenceOnEnter,
            $endConferenceOnExit,
            $waitUrl,
            $waitMethod,
            $earlyMedia,
            $maxParticipants,
            $conferenceRecord,
            $conferenceTrim,
            $conferenceStatusCallback,
            $conferenceStatusCallbackMethod,
            $conferenceStatusCallbackEvent,
            $recordingChannels,
            $recordingStatusCallback,
            $recordingStatusCallbackMethod,
            $sipAuthUsername,
            $sipAuthPassword,
            $region,
            $conferenceRecordingStatusCallback,
            $conferenceRecordingStatusCallbackMethod,
            $recordingStatusCallbackEvent,
            $conferenceRecordingStatusCallbackEvent,
            $coaching,
            $callSidToCoach,
            $jitterBufferSize,
            $byoc,
            $callerId,
            $callReason,
            $recordingTrack,
            $timeLimit,
            $machineDetection,
            $machineDetectionTimeout,
            $machineDetectionSpeechThreshold,
            $machineDetectionSpeechEndThreshold,
            $machineDetectionSilenceTimeout,
            $amdStatusCallback,
            $amdStatusCallbackMethod,
            $trim,
            $callToken
        );
    }



    /**
     * @param bool $muted Whether to return only participants that are muted. Can be: `true` or `false`.
     * @param bool $hold Whether to return only participants that are on hold. Can be: `true` or `false`.
     * @param bool $coaching Whether to return only participants who are coaching another call. Can be: `true` or `false`.
     * @return ReadParticipantOptions Options builder
     */
    public static function read(
        
        bool $muted =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        bool $hold =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        bool $coaching = Values::BOOL_NONE

    ): ReadParticipantOptions
    {
        return new ReadParticipantOptions(
            $muted,
            $hold,
            $coaching
        );
    }

    /**
     * @param bool $muted Whether the participant should be muted. Can be `true` or `false`. `true` will mute the participant, and `false` will un-mute them. Anything value other than `true` or `false` is interpreted as `false`.
     * @param bool $hold Whether the participant should be on hold. Can be: `true` or `false`. `true` puts the participant on hold, and `false` lets them rejoin the conference.
     * @param string $holdUrl The URL we call using the `hold_method` for music that plays when the participant is on hold. The URL may return an MP3 file, a WAV file, or a TwiML document that contains `<Play>`, `<Say>`, `<Pause>`, or `<Redirect>` verbs.
     * @param string $holdMethod The HTTP method we should use to call `hold_url`. Can be: `GET` or `POST` and the default is `GET`.
     * @param string $announceUrl The URL we call using the `announce_method` for an announcement to the participant. The URL may return an MP3 file, a WAV file, or a TwiML document that contains `<Play>`, `<Say>`, `<Pause>`, or `<Redirect>` verbs.
     * @param string $announceMethod The HTTP method we should use to call `announce_url`. Can be: `GET` or `POST` and defaults to `POST`.
     * @param string $waitUrl The URL we call using the `wait_method` for the music to play while participants are waiting for the conference to start. The URL may return an MP3 file, a WAV file, or a TwiML document that contains `<Play>`, `<Say>`, `<Pause>`, or `<Redirect>` verbs. The default value is the URL of our standard hold music. [Learn more about hold music](https://www.twilio.com/labs/twimlets/holdmusic).
     * @param string $waitMethod The HTTP method we should use to call `wait_url`. Can be `GET` or `POST` and the default is `POST`. When using a static audio file, this should be `GET` so that we can cache the file.
     * @param bool $beepOnExit Whether to play a notification beep to the conference when the participant exits. Can be: `true` or `false`.
     * @param bool $endConferenceOnExit Whether to end the conference when the participant leaves. Can be: `true` or `false` and defaults to `false`.
     * @param bool $coaching Whether the participant is coaching another call. Can be: `true` or `false`. If not present, defaults to `false` unless `call_sid_to_coach` is defined. If `true`, `call_sid_to_coach` must be defined.
     * @param string $callSidToCoach The SID of the participant who is being `coached`. The participant being coached is the only participant who can hear the participant who is `coaching`.
     * @return UpdateParticipantOptions Options builder
     */
    public static function update(
        
        bool $muted =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        bool $hold =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        string $holdUrl = Values::NONE,
        string $holdMethod = Values::NONE,
        string $announceUrl = Values::NONE,
        string $announceMethod = Values::NONE,
        string $waitUrl = Values::NONE,
        string $waitMethod = Values::NONE,
        bool $beepOnExit =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        bool $endConferenceOnExit =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        bool $coaching = Values::BOOL_NONE,
        string $callSidToCoach = Values::NONE

    ): UpdateParticipantOptions
    {
        return new UpdateParticipantOptions(
            $muted,
            $hold,
            $holdUrl,
            $holdMethod,
            $announceUrl,
            $announceMethod,
            $waitUrl,
            $waitMethod,
            $beepOnExit,
            $endConferenceOnExit,
            $coaching,
            $callSidToCoach
        );
    }

}
